I am using a somewhat modified version of IsoApplet. Up till now it worked fine. However recently I stumbled upon a web site that forces a client cert auth with RSA-PSS. And (at least on windows, using minidriver) it didn't work. It looks to me, that it's a bug in the PSS support code in minidriver, as I cannot find any place where a MGF1 padding scheme is specified. And since none is specified signing fails. This patch fixes this. It assumes, that the same hash is used for hashing and padding. |
